About this opportunity Are you ready to launch your geoscience career and make an impact in the energy sector? Cenovus is looking for a curious, engaged, and driven Geologist-in-Training to join our New Grad Program. This is your opportunity to take on real energy challenges, grow your skills, and help shape the future of our industry. Our Program consists of three consecutive 12-month rotational assignments that span Cenovus’s varied business areas. Upon completion of the three-year program, you will be matched to a permanent role within the organization. This role will be based on business need and relocation may be required. You will join a dynamic team that values continuous learning, collaboration, and innovation. Over the course of the three-year program, you’ll be paired with multiple experienced geoscience professionals who will mentor you through each rotation and support your technical and qualified growth. Each rotation offers the opportunity to explore different areas of development across our portfolio of assets including SAGD oilsands, heavy oil, unconventionals, and offshore.

What you’ll do Interpret well logs and core data to build structure and isopach maps to better understand reservoir quality.
Work as part of a multidisciplinary team including Geophysicists and Engineers to characterize the reservoir, plan new pads and optimize well placement while drilling.
Evaluate surveillance data on existing pads to optimize existing production.
Work alongside Engineers to evaluate and present business opportunities.
Communicate findings to the broader geoscience and subsurface teams.
Who you are Legally authorized to work in Canada.
Available to begin work June 2027.
Must have an undergraduate or graduate Geology‑related degree obtained by May 31, 2027, and completed within the last 2 years (2025, 2026 or by May 31, 2027).
Has less than two years of professional experience related to this discipline of study, excluding student experience.
Exposure to software such as Petrel, Accumap, Geoscout, or Geographix would be considered an asset.




Must be eligible to register for your professional Geoscientist‑in‑Training designation.

About Cenovus Cenovus is an integrated energy company headquartered in Calgary. We’re committed to maximizing value by developing our assets in a safe, responsible and cost‑efficient manner. We operate in Canada, the United States and the Asia Pacific region. Our operations include oil sands projects in northern Alberta, thermal and conventional crude oil and natural gas projects across Western Canada, crude oil production offshore Newfoundland and Labrador and natural gas and liquids production offshore China and Indonesia. Cenovus’s downstream operations include upgrading, refining and marketing operations in Canada and the United States. Our shares trade under the symbol CVE, and are listed on the Toronto and New York stock exchanges.
